Types of soldering stations
The first step in choosing a soldering station is to understand the different types available in the market. The two primary types of soldering stations are:1. Analog soldering stations:
Analog soldering stations are the traditional type of soldering station that uses a dial knob to control the temperature. These are less expensive than digital soldering stations but offer less accuracy and require adjustments to maintain the right temperature.2. Digital soldering stations:
Digital soldering stations are the modern type of soldering station that uses an electronic display to show the temperature. These come with digital controls for temperature adjustment and offer better accuracy, stability and productivity.Temperature control
Temperature control is one of the critical factors to consider when selecting a soldering station. A soldering station with accurate temperature control ensures that you can achieve the right solder joints without damaging delicate components.1. Temperature range:
Different soldering applications require different temperatures, so it is essential to choose a station with a temperature range that matches your needs. For example, electronics soldering requires a temperature range of 300-400°C, while soldering heavy-duty materials such as copper or brass requires temperatures over 400°C.2. Temperature stability:
Temperature stability is equally important as temperature range. A soldering station with temperature stability ensures that the temperature does not fluctuate, leading to damaged components or inadequate solder joints. A digital soldering station offers better temperature stability than analog soldering stations.Power and wattage
The power and wattage of a soldering station determine the heating speed and the maximum temperature the tool can reach. Soldering stations come in different wattages, usually ranging from 40W to 100W.1. Power:
If you plan to use your soldering station for small-scale applications such as electronics or jewelry making, choose a low to medium-powered station. For heavy-duty applications such as plumbing, a high-powered station is recommended.2. Wattage:
Higher wattage soldering stations can heat up faster and maintain temperature better than low wattage stations. However, high wattage soldering tools require more power and can be more challenging to handle than their low wattage counterparts.Soldering iron tips
Soldering iron tips are replaceable and are available in different shapes and sizes. Choose a soldering station with a variety of tip options to fit your application and ensure precise soldering.1. Tip shape:
Different tip shapes are suitable for different applications, such as pointed tips for precision work and chisel tips for larger solder joints. Choose a soldering station that provides various tip shapes to fit your needs.2. Tip size:
Tip size also plays a crucial role in determining the quality of the solder joint. Choose a soldering station with a range of tip sizes to match the size of the component you're soldering.Quality
Soldering stations come in different quality levels, and it's essential to choose a quality product to ensure longevity and safety.1. Brand reputation:
Choose a reputable brand when purchasing a soldering station to ensure quality and reliability. Look for brands with excellent customer support and warranty policies.2. Material quality:
Choose a soldering station made of high-quality materials such as stainless steel for durability and resistance to wear and tear. Soldering stations made of low-quality materials can result in decreased performance and safety issues.3. Safety features:
Ensure that the selected soldering station has appropriate safety features such as auto shut-off, grounded plugs, and temperature controls to avoid accidents and prevent overheating.Ease of use and portability
An easy-to-use soldering station can help improve your soldering skills and productivity. Also, consider the portability of the soldering station if you need to move it around.1. Ergonomic design:
Choose a soldering station with an ergonomic design that fits comfortably in your hand and does not strain your wrist muscles.2. Durability:
Choose a sturdy and durable soldering station that can withstand regular use and occasional falls.3. Portability:
If you need to move your soldering station frequently, choose a compact and lightweight tool that is easy to carry and store.Conclusion
Choosing the right soldering station is essential for achieving accurate and safe solder joints. When selecting a soldering station, consider the temperature control, power and wattage, soldering iron tips, quality, ease of use, and portability.
